Egress window installation services involve creating or modifying windows to meet specific safety and building code requirements, primarily for basement or below-grade spaces. The process typically includes excavating around the foundation, enlarging or installing new window openings, and fitting windows that are designed to provide a safe exit in emergencies. Proper installation ensures the window is secure, functional, and compliant with local safety standards, making it an essential upgrade for homeowners seeking to improve basement safety and accessibility.

This service addresses common problems such as limited escape routes in emergencies, poor natural light, and ventilation issues in basement areas. Egress windows provide a vital means of escape during fires or other emergencies, reducing potential hazards for occupants. Additionally, they can enhance the overall livability of basement spaces by increasing natural light and airflow, which can make below-ground rooms more inviting and functional. Properly installed egress windows can also increase property value by meeting safety regulations and improving the usability of basement areas.

Material and Design Costs - The cost for materials and design options typically ranges from $500 to $2,500, depending on window size and style. Custom or high-end designs can increase expenses beyond this range.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ific project requirements.

Labor Expenses - Installation labor costs generally fall between $1,000 and $3,000. Factors influencing labor costs include window size, accessibility, and existing structure modifications needed. Prices may vary by location and contractor.

Permitting and Inspection Fees - Permitting and inspection costs usually range from $100 to $500, depending on local regulations. Some areas require permits for egress window installations, which can add to the overall project cost. Local service providers can assist with permit acquisition.

Total Project Cost - Overall expenses for egress window installation typically range from $2,000 to $8,000. This includes materials, labor, permits, and additional modifications. Contact local pros for tailored quotes based on specific project details.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is an egress window? An egress window is a large, accessible window designed to provide a safe exit in case of emergency, often required in basements or bedrooms.

Are egress windows required by building codes? Building codes typically require egress windows in bedrooms and basements to ensure safe escape routes during emergencies.

What are common types of egress windows? Common types include casement, sliding, and double-hung windows, each offering different aesthetic and functional options.

How long does egress window installation usually take? Installation times can vary based on the project scope, but generally, it can take from one to several days.
